mongodb3.2配置文件yaml格式
发表于:2025-01-20 作者:千家信息网编辑
千家信息网最后更新 2025年01月20日,mongodb3.x版本后就是要yaml语法格式的配置文件,下面是yaml配置文件格式如下:官方yaml配置文件选项参考:https://docs.mongodb.org/manual/referen
千家信息网最后更新 2025年01月20日mongodb3.2配置文件yaml格式
mongodb3.x版本后就是要yaml语法格式的配置文件,下面是yaml配置文件格式如下:
官方yaml配置文件选项参考:https://docs.mongodb.org/manual/reference/configuration-options/#configuration-file
只能使用空格,不支持tab键,切记,原因你懂的。。。。。。
systemLog: destination: file//指定是一个文件 path: /data/logs/mongod.log//日志存放位置 logAppend: true//产生日志内容追加到文件# quiet: true//在quite模式下会限制输出信息# timeStampFormat: iso8601-utc //默认是iso8601-local,日志信息中还有其他时间戳格式:ctime,iso8601-utc,iso8601-local
processManagement: fork: true//以守护进程的方式运行MongoDB,创建服务器进程 pidFilePath: "/data/mongo-data/mongod.pid"//pid文件路径net:# bindIp: 192.168.33.131//绑定ip地址访问mongodb,多个ip逗号分隔 port: 27017//端口 maxIncomingConnections:10000//默认65535,mongodb实例接受的最多连接数,如果高于操作系统接受的最大线程数,设置无效。# http:# enabled: true//http端口最好关闭#RESTInterfaceEnabled: false//即使http接口选项关闭,如果这个选项打开后会有更多的不安全因素
storage: dbPath: "/data/mongo-data"//数据文件存放路径 engine: wiredTiger//数据引擎 wiredTiger: engineConfig://wt引擎配置 cacheSizeGB: 1//看服务器情况来进行设置 directoryForIndexes: true//索引是否按数据库名进行单独存储 collectionConfig: blockCompressor: zlib//压缩配置 indexConfig: prefixCompression: true//索引配置 journal: enabled: true//记录操作日志,防止数据丢失。 directoryPerDB: true//指定存储每个数据库文件到单独的数据目录。如果在一个已存在的系统使用该选项,需要事先把存在的数据文件移动到目录。operationProfiling: slowOpThresholdMs: 100 //指定慢查询时间,单位毫秒,如果打开功能,则向system.profile集合写入数据 mode: "slowOp"//off、slowOp、all,分别对应关闭,仅打开慢查询,记录所有操作。security: keyFile: "/data/mongodb-keyfile"//指定分片集或副本集成员之间身份验证的key文件存储位置 clusterAuthMode: "keyFile"//集群认证模式,默认是keyFile authorization: "disabled"//访问数据库和进行操作的用户角色认证
复制集相关配置,根据以上配置文件进行如下配置。
replication: oplogSizeMB: 50//默认为磁盘的5%,指定oplog的最大尺寸。对于已经建立过oplog.rs的数据库,指定无效 replSetName: "rs_zxl"//指定副本集的名称 secondaryIndexPrefetch: "all"//指定副本集成员在接受oplog之前是否加载索引到内存。默认会加载所有的索引到内存。none不加载;all加载所有;_id_only仅加载_id
分片集群配置,分片复制集配置(单实例节点的基础上)
replication: oplogSizeMB:50 replSetName: "rs_zxl"sharding: clusterRole: shardsvr
config server配置(单实例节点的基础上)
sharding: clusterRole: configsvr
mongos配置,(与单实例不同)
systemLog: destination: file path: /data/logs/mongos.log logAppend: truenet: port: 27019sharding: configDB: 192.168.33.131:30000
配置
文件
数据
实例
数据库
日志
索引
格式
副本
存储
最大
位置
信息
内存
基础
引擎
时间
服务器
模式
目录
数据库的安全要保护哪些东西
数据库安全各自的含义是什么
生产安全数据库录入
数据库的安全性及管理
数据库安全策略包含哪些
海淀数据库安全审计系统
建立农村房屋安全信息数据库
易用的数据库客户端支持安全管理
连接数据库失败ssl安全错误
数据库的锁怎样保障安全
我的世界服务器怎么换简介
软件开发失败案例
网络安全知多少 教案
江门采购管理软件开发
2021江西网络安全评选
java开发与软件开发
vb如何往数据库储存数据
保密周网络安全
用手机制作数据库
数据库冗余度和安全性的关系
西电网络安全
云服务器实践教程案例
网络安全绘画作品一二年级
软件系统网络安全协议
青穗广州互联网科技有限公司
服务器比机柜小多少
数据库连接要导包
凯尔安德森数据库
广州云储网络技术有限公司业务
江苏常规网络技术参考价格
时间序列数据库重启
锦江区慧龙软件开发工作室
新网服务器管理平台
优麒麟架设服务器
用友pdm数据库字典
广西应用软件开发费用
网络技术员的职责
科技公司都是互联网公司吗
分布式数据库sql审核平台
云服务器和空间